The intelligence layer
Device data becomes more valuable when an agent can interpret it in operational context, work across your systems and move the next step forward.
Agents read live equipment signals, recognize abnormal behaviour and open the right maintenance workflow before downtime spreads.
Device telemetry gives support teams context before they respond, while agents group symptoms and recommend the next diagnostic step.
Sensors establish where an asset is and how it is being used; agents reconcile that state with inventory, service and dispatch systems.
Agents combine meter, weather and operating data to surface waste, tune schedules and escalate exceptions with evidence attached.
Connected fixtures capture test results at the source, while agents trace recurring failures to components, lots or process conditions.
Agents monitor distributed devices, distinguish a true field exception from noise and coordinate the technician, part or response required.
